Safety

If you're thinking of purchasing bunk beds, you must make sure it's built properly and meets safety standards. Bunk beds are frequently injured due to poor construction.

A bunk bed for sale should be a solid wood frame, with solid legs and a sturdy railing. This will make sure that children don't fall off the beds, and end up hurting themselves. You should also ensure that the beds are constructed from safe materials, like pine or soft wood.

CPSC has set strict standards for bunk beds to prevent entrapment injuries, which is among the leading causes of injuries among children. These standards include requirements for guardrails and openings tests and certification.

Bunk beds must have railings at least 5" above the mattress to avoid entrapment. The guardrails on the bunk beds must be in a continuous fashion and not have any gaps that could allow a child to get through.

The CPSC has also set guidelines for the kind of connection that connects the top and bottom bunks. These beds should utilize two of the approved connections which include a wooden dowel and simple holes drilled into the supports or a metal fastener that connects the bunks on top and bottom.

Additionally, the gaps in the upper bunk structure should be narrow enough (less than 3.5 inches) that the child's head, arms or torso are unable to pass through the openings. This is designed to prevent children from falling off the bed or getting trapped between the railings and slat kit.

The gap between the slats and guardrails should not be more than 3.5 inches. If there is an opening between the slat kit's guardrails and the slat kits, then it must be covered by a cushioned railing to stop a child falling through it.
